Education Dept Probes University of Michigan Over Funding

The University of Michigan is in the crosshairs of the Education Department over potential unreported foreign funding and influence that the Trump administration has linked to “agroterrorism.”

The government has notified the Ann Arbor, Michigan-based university that it has opened a “foreign funding investigation” after a review of the university’s financials, “revealed inaccurate and incomplete disclosures.”

Education Department’s chief investigative counsel, Paul Moore, said tens of millions of dollars “have been reported in an untimely manner,” but further, “appear to erroneously identify some of UM’s foreign funders as nongovernmental entities, even though the foreign funders seem to be directly affiliated with foreign governments.”
